What is it called when you believe in fate and destiny?
Fatalism is a family of related philosophical doctrines that stress the subjugation of all events or actions to fate or destiny, and is commonly associated with the consequent attitude of resignation in the face of future events which are thought to be inevitable.What do you call one who firmly believes in fate or destiny?
Detailed SolutionThe correct answer is Fatalist.

What is the Latin word for fate?
The Latin word for fate is fatum, which literally means "what has been spoken." Fatum, in turn, comes from fari, meaning "to speak." In the eyes of the ancients, your fate was out of your hands-what happened was up to gods and demigods.What is a symbol of fate?
A symbol for fate is the “spindle” of the Moirai, Greek divinities of Fate (Parcae in Latin mythology).What is fate known as?

"DESTINY" IS A COMMON SYNONYM FOR WHAT philosophers call teleology--the idea that events follow a set plan that has a purpose. Teleology is primarily defined as a belief in "final ends" or ultimate goals that constrain reality in such a way that those ends or goals will be reached.What does the Bible say about destiny?
